arrow
v58.1.0 StableRust implementation of Apache Arrow
Quick Verdict
- ✓Actively maintained (updated 3d ago)
- ✓Stable API (58.x for 8+ years)
- ✓Massive adoption (14.5K crates depend on it)
- !Heavy dependency tree (23 direct deps)
- ✓Permissive license (Apache-2.0)
Security
Deep Insights
5.0M downloads in the last 30 days (167.9K/day), up 58% from the previous period.
14.5K crates depend on arrow — it's part of the Rust ecosystem's core infrastructure. Removing it from your dependency tree would be extremely difficult.
The primary maintainer publishes 98 crates. This suggests deep Rust expertise and long-term commitment to the ecosystem.
The API has been stable (1.x) for over 8 years with 110 releases. This level of maturity means you can depend on it without worrying about breaking changes.
23 direct dependencies. Consider the impact on compile times and supply chain complexity.
Notable dependents include parquet, datafusion, datafusion-common, datafusion-expr, datafusion-physical-expr. When high-quality crates choose arrow, it's a strong quality signal.
Health Breakdown
Recency, release consistency, active ratio
Yanked ratio, deps, size, maturity, features
Reverse deps, ownership, ecosystem
Downloads, momentum, growth trend
Docs, repo, license, metadata
Download Trend
Top Dependents
Most downloaded crates that depend on arrow
Version Adoption
Release Timeline
Feature Flags
default =["csv", "ipc", "json"]